After getting a 28s, I pondered a way to keep the equations seperate from the
variables and create a nice neat way of executing math programs: I've come up
with the following:

I have a directory for each class as such:

Root--->Me237--->work
     |->Ce474--->work
     |->Ce273--->work
     etc. & etc.

so that each directory has it's own work directory (to keep class data 
seperate) 

 so in the me327 (Thermodynamics) directory, I will have a program for 
 interpolation, It appears as:

     NTRP
     << '(B-C)*(X-Z)/(A-C)+Z' 
	WORK CLUSER STEQ         | changes to work directory
	1DE26h SYSEVAL >>        | clears directory, stores equation,
				 | and calls solver.

when finished with the solver, if you need to use another equation and 
know it from memory, since it is in the path, just type it  and it
will load,purge variables and adjust the variables used in solver, and 
really isn't a problem if you keep the commands to 2 or 3 letters.
